You are asked to find the index of refraction for an unknown fluid, using only a laser and a michelson interferometer. a michelson interferometer consists of two arms--paths that light travels down, which end in mirrors--attached around a beam splitter. (figure 1)the beam splitter separates the incoming light into two separate beams and then recombines them once they return from the ends of the arms. the recombined beams are sent to a telescope, where their interference pattern may be observed in detail.
